Sunrisers Eastern Cape ease past MI Cape Town by 7 wickets in SA20 clash

Match overview

Sunrisers Eastern Cape beat MI Cape Town by 7 wickets at St George's Park, Port Elizabeth on 18 January 2026, in a SA20 T20 fixture that was largely settled during the middle overs of the chase. MI Cape Town batted first and posted 148/6, a total that looked competitive on paper but sat 38 runs below the venue's average first-innings score of 186 across 133 T20 matches at this ground. Sunrisers, who won the toss and chose to field, knocked off the target with seven wickets in hand. MP Breetzke was named Player of the Match for his contribution to a controlled run chase.

MI Cape Town's innings had its moments. They closed the powerplay on 43/1, a reasonable start, and added 50 runs for 2 wickets through the middle overs before accelerating late: 55 runs came off the final four overs at the cost of 3 wickets. The problem was that the platform built in the first ten overs was never fully exploited, and 148 gave Sunrisers a task rather than a challenge.

The Sunrisers reply told a different story. After a powerplay of 37/1, the chase was effectively decided in the middle phase. Overs 7 to 15 produced 68 runs without a single wicket falling, a sequence that took the game away from MI Cape Town. Sunrisers wobbled slightly at the death, losing 2 wickets while scoring 44, but by then the result was not in doubt.

Venue and conditions

St George's Park is a ground that tends to reward bowling first, though the numbers are less emphatic than at some South African venues. The chase success rate here sits at 49 per cent across the ground's T20 history, meaning teams electing to field are not doing so with a significant statistical advantage. What the ground does offer is reliable powerplay pace: the average powerplay score of 36 runs gives captains a reasonable benchmark, and both sides came close to matching it, with MI Cape Town scoring 43 in theirs and Sunrisers 37.

The death overs at this venue average 33 runs. MI Cape Town's death phase produced 55, above the norm, and that difference proved important in getting them to a defendable total. The middle overs are where this match was lost by MI Cape Town and won by Sunrisers. St George's tends to offer pace and bounce that makes the middle phase genuinely competitive, but Sunrisers negotiated it without any loss of wickets, which is unusual even by the standards of comfortable chases.

Recent form

MI Cape Town came into this fixture with a mixed run of results: wins over Joburg Super Kings (twice) and Sunrisers Eastern Cape in their most recent encounter, offset by defeats to Pretoria Capitals and Paarl Royals. Their win over Sunrisers earlier in 2026, by 3 wickets at Newlands, will sting the Eastern Cape side and underlines how fine the margins are between these teams.

Sunrisers' form had been similarly uneven. Before this match, their 2026 SA20 results included a loss to MI Cape Town, a win over Joburg Super Kings, a defeat to Durban's Super Giants, and a win over Pretoria Capitals. A home win on a familiar pitch will do their confidence no harm, and they now lead the all-time head-to-head series 5 wins to 4 across the nine meetings these sides have played.
